The most important and also the best known degradation pathway\u00a0is autophagy, where a sequestrating membrane\u00a0separates a part of the cytoplasm so forming an\u00a0autophagic vacuole. Degradation of the autophagic vacuole ingredients starts after the fusion of the\u00a0autophagic vacuole with a lysosome. Some cytosolic proteins are introduced to a lysosom by\u00a0a heat-shock protein (Hsp 70) in a process called\u00a0carrier mediated proteolysis. Another pathway of\u00a0lysosomal protein degradation is crinophagy where\u00a0the secretory vesicles containing newly synthesised\u00a0proteins fuse with the lysosomal membrane instead\u00a0of fusing with the plasma membrane. Part of the\u00a0proteolysis is localised in the cytosol and is known\u00a0as nonlysosomal proteolysis. In this degradation,\u00a0large protein complexes proteasomes and protein\u00a0ubiquitin are involved. The degradation products\u00a0are reused for the synthesis of new cell components. Thus degradation processes are involved\u00a0in recycling of the cell ingredients.<\/p>\n","protected":false},"excerpt":{"rendered":"<p>The degradation of cell ingredients\u00a0takes place mainly in lysosomes.
